What are some typical challenges faced by remote Developer Relations professionals, and how can they effectively overcome them?

Remote Developer Relations professionals often face challenges such as building genuine relationships with developer communities without in-person interactions, staying aligned with distributed teams, and managing time zones. To overcome these, it's important to leverage digital communication tools, attend and host virtual events, and schedule regular check-ins with both internal teams and external communities. Proactive communication, clear documentation, and participating in online forums can help maintain strong connections and foster engagement.

What is the difference between Remote Developer Relations vs Remote Developer Support?

AspectRemote Developer RelationsRemote Developer Support
Primary FocusBuilding developer communities, advocacy, outreach, and fostering relationships with developersProviding technical assistance, troubleshooting, and resolving developer issues with products or APIs
Required SkillsCommunication, community engagement, technical knowledge, evangelismTechnical troubleshooting, customer service, product knowledge
Work EnvironmentCollaborative, outreach-focused, often involves events and content creationSupport tickets, direct communication, technical problem-solving
Industry UsageTech companies, API providers, open-source projectsSoftware companies, SaaS providers, tech support teams

Remote Developer Relations primarily focuses on engaging with the developer community, promoting products, and building relationships. In contrast, Remote Developer Support centers on assisting developers with technical issues and troubleshooting. Both roles require technical knowledge, but their goals and daily activities differ significantly.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Developer Relations profess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Developer Relations professional, you need a strong background in software development, technical writing, and community engagement, often supported by a degree in computer science or related experience. Familiarity with developer tools, APIs, documentation platforms, and social media management systems is typically required. Exceptional communication, relationship-building, and self-motivation are vital soft skills for connecting with diverse developer communities and collaborating across remote teams. These skills foster trust, drive product adoption, and support successful outreach in a distributed environment.

What are Remote Developer Relations?

Remote Developer Relations, often called DevRel, is a role focused on building and nurturing relationships between a company and the developer community, all while working remotely. These professionals advocate for the needs of developers, create educational content, host virtual events, and provide feedback to internal teams to improve products. Remote DevRel specialists use online platforms, social media, webinars, and forums to engage with developers worldwide. Their goal is to foster a strong, supportive community and help developers succeed with the company's tools or platforms.

Position Summary:

Tetra Tech is seeking a Regional Client Manager residing in Florida with a proven sales and program management track record in developing business in solid waste hauling initiatives in the private and public sector along with other state and federal programs. In this role, the selected candidate will market Tetra Tech's disaster recovery, solid waste initiatives and consulting services to business, local, state and federal government clients. This role will provide significant coverage across the State of Florida and surrounding states which will require necessary business travel in these areas.

Essential Job Functions:

The following duties are considered essential to the role. Reasonable accommodation may be provided to enable individuals with disabilities to perform these essential functions:

  • Manage aspects of business development and client relations including performing market assessments, client identification, and matching client needs with Tetra Tech technical capabilities.
  • Foster new and existing Tetra Tech client relationships with local parishes, state partners and businesses within the industry with an emphasis on expanding Tetra Tech's disaster recovery client base in the region.
  • Develop business opportunities that meet Tetra Tech sales goals and objectives at a state regional level.
  • Support and guide the development of effective capture strategies for targeted opportunities and be able to increase sales and operations across our chosen end markets.
  • Meet assigned goals and work closely with Tetra Tech technical staff to deliver high-quality, cost-effective work products for our clients
  • Preparing proposals, project cost estimates, and client interview documents
  • Successfully assist target clients in the planning and timely implementation of their projects
  • Communicate with senior leadership staff from clients including elected officials.
  • Interface with federal, state, and local officials as required to support clients' needs
  • Identify and resolve issues and conflicts
  • Support other Tetra Tech staff assigned to projects
  • Adhere to all relevant federal, state, and local laws, regulations, and policies of disaster recovery.
  • Conduct activities in line with internal procedures, legislation, and industry standards.
  • Pursue continuous professional development and maintain a high degree of discipline, knowledge and awareness.
  • Work in a safe manner at all times and report all health and safety incidents and concerns.
  • Additional duties as required.

Required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ree is desired with 15+ years' experience with strong public sector relationships.
  • Ability to secure and manage multi-million-dollar, large scale, multi-year project contracts.
  • Experience implementing debris and solid waste hauling programs.
  • Experience in financial administration of internal controls, compliance, budgets, financial reporting, and analysis.
  • Strong computer skills, work ethics, integrity, and teamwork background.
  • Possess a track record building and maintain relationships with clients, senior managers, and executives.
